Problems solved by technology

Since the spent fuel pool contains radioactive particles and hot particles with high radiation doses are very easy to attach to the outer surface of the storage container, when the storage container is hoisted out of the spent fuel pool, in order to ensure that the pollution level of the outer surface of the storage container meets the on-site transportation standard, now The stage method is to arrange two flushing personnel to carry out spray guns in the process of lifting the container from the refueling well to wash the surface of the container at 360 degrees all the time. After the storage container is loaded with spent fuel assemblies, it is lifted to above the liquid level of the spent fuel pool. , due to the lack of good shielding of water, the radiation level of the storage container will gradually increase, even if the personnel have been working all the time, it is impossible to ensure that every part of the container surface can be rinsed in place
Moreover, due to the high radiation level on the surface of the container, there are also potential radiant heat particles, and it is easy to produce high doses of radiation to the surrounding flushing personnel. In addition, personnel need to stand by the pool to manually flush the surface of the container. There is also a large industrial Safety risks also bring challenges to the first-level anti-foreign body requirements in nuclear fuel pools

Abstract

The invention belongs to the technical field of mechanical design, and particularly relates to a device suitable for flushing the surface of a spent fuel dry-method storage container. The device comprises a flushing water tank, flushing supports, flushing sprayers, flushing pipes and quick connectors; and the multiple flushing pipes form a loop through the quick connectors, each flushing pipe is provided with one flushing sprayer and one flushing support used for fixing, and one flushing pipe is connected with the flushing water tank. Radiation risks and industrial risks caused by the fact that personnel stand beside a spent fuel pool to flush the surface of the storage container are avoided, the surface pollution level of the full-load spent fuel container meets the radioactive substancetransportation standard in a nuclear power plant, meanwhile, the radiation dosage borne by the personnel when the personnel flush the storage container is reduced, the operation time of the personnelduring near-edge operation is shortened, risks of the personnel during near-edge operation are reduced, the operation process is optimized, and the safety of the personnel and equipment is ensured.

Description

technical field [0001] The invention belongs to the technical field of mechanical design, and in particular relates to a device suitable for surface flushing of spent fuel dry storage containers. Background technique [0002] In the early stage of construction of a nuclear power plant, a pool for storing spent fuel was built. Due to the limitation of the storage capacity of the spent fuel pool, with the increase of the operating life of the unit, the number of spent fuel components produced increased year by year. Conventional storage can no longer meet the rapid development of China's nuclear power industry. develop. With the development and utilization of China's nuclear power technology, the domestic nuclear power industry has gradually introduced, digested, absorbed and implemented the dry storage technology of spent fuel.
